A 33 hour low-pass filter is applied to the hourly time series. The plot below was created with these Ferret commands (33hrfilt is a local file containing the filter weights, the weight values are shown in the output above)
DEFINE AXIS/T=-33:33:1/UNITS=hour TAX1 DEFINE GRID/t=TAX1 g2 FILE/VAR=WEIGHTS33T/GRID=G2 "./33hrfilt" SET VAR/TITLE="33 Hour Filter Weights" WEIGHTS33T PLOT WEIGHTS33T FRAME/FILE=weights33.gif

The plot below shows an example of the high diurnal and tidal frequency energies contained in mooring time series data. The red line is the fourier transform of the above filter. Its sharp cutoff at 33 hours helps preserve low frequency energies and virtually eliminate the high frequency energies which could be aliased to lower frequencies if we did not apply this filter before sub-sampling to one day intervals. To use FFTA on data from other moorings which have multiple deployments, and hence gaps in the time axis, you need to first regrid the data onto a regular time axis. Here are the Ferret command to do that:
set mem/size=20 def sym tst="`U_UNCORRECTED_HR,return=tstart`" def sym ten="`U_UNCORRECTED_HR,return=tend`" def axis/t=():():1/units=hour treg let u_reg = U_UNCORRECTED_HR[gt=treg] ! Can now pass u_reg to FFTA, or save it to a file...
